Liverpool forward Sadio Mane has been taken to hospital after suffering a shoulder injury in training.
Mane sustained the problem during a session at Melwood on Wednesday ahead of the Reds’ Premier League encounter with Burnley this weekend.
A member of the club’s medical staff accompanied the Senegal international, 24, as he left Liverpool’s training ground in West Derby.
The £30 million summer arrival from Southampton will undergo a scan on the injury which threatens to rule him out of Saturday’s trip to Turf Moor.
He had left a good first impression on the Anfield faithful with a goal on his debut in last Sunday’s seven-goal thriller with Arsenal.
